Murray Stahl is chairman of Horizon Kinetics, an investment firm known for independent research and unconventional long-term themes. The firm has been closely associated with ideas such as hard assets, owner-operator businesses, and differentiated equity research outside the consensus. Stahl’s commentaries are followed by investors interested in structural market inefficiencies and long-duration themes.

Murray Stahl's Q1 2022 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2022, Murray Stahl held 361 positions worth $4.96B, up 9.3% from $4.54B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 63% of the portfolio.

Murray Stahl deployed $198M of net new capital in Q1 2022, opening 12 new positions and adding to 80 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Bunge Global: 351,540 shares worth $39M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Energy at 47% of assets, up from 46%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Materials.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was PayPal, an estimated $9.06M trimmed.
